When considering private health insurance in Las Cruces, it’s important to understand the different types of plans available. The main types include Health Maintenance Organizations (HMOs), Preferred Provider Organizations (PPOs), Exclusive Provider Organizations (EPOs), and Point of Service (POS) plans.
HMOs typically require members to choose a primary care physician and get referrals for specialist care, while PPOs offer more flexibility in choosing healthcare providers. EPOs are similar to PPOs but do not cover out-of-network care except in emergencies, and POS plans combine features of HMOs and PPOs. Each type of plan has its advantages and disadvantages, so it’s important to consider your healthcare needs and preferences when choosing a plan.
Choosing the right private health insurance in Las Cruces involves considering several factors, including your healthcare needs, budget, and preferred healthcare providers. Start by evaluating the coverage options and benefits each plan offers. Consider whether the plan covers the healthcare services you and your family need most frequently.
It’s also important to consider the cost of premiums, deductibles, co-pays, and out-of-pocket maximums. Balancing these costs with the level of coverage provided can help you find a plan that fits your budget while still offering comprehensive coverage. Additionally, check if your preferred healthcare providers are included in the plan’s network to ensure you can continue receiving care from them.

In general, you can only enroll in private health insurance during the open enrollment period, which for 2025 is from November 1, 2024, to January 15, 2025. However, you may be eligible to enroll outside of this period if you experience a qualifying life event, such as losing other health coverage, getting married, or having a baby.
